The EMC ELECTRICAL MECHANICAL COMPANY 401(k) on its latest Form 5500

EMC ELECTRICAL MECHANICAL COMPANY (EIN 73-1421137) reports EMC ELECTRICAL MECHANICAL COMPANY 401(K) P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$376K in plan assets across 16 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the EMC ELECTRICAL MECHANICAL COMPANY 401(k)?

EMC ELECTRICAL MECHANICAL COMPANY’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ask EMC ELECTRICAL MECHANICAL COMPANYHR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
